Re: What did you do today in the hobby?
Yeah the fuse kept blowing. Rottendog Board was locked on for that lower right VUK coil as well as the right slingshot. Put back in the Original board that had apparently been refusbished by an “expert” in BC. Dear god. Hack of a repair(lifted traces, blobs of solder not even making contact to anything, trace jumpered amateurely). So then Left ramp coil was not working. Had to hack the board hack. Left ramp coil was now getting triggered but coil high power was not working (eos switch corroded). Motor (rotating flipper) relay was not working and when I fixed it the motor power contacts were corroded and not making contact. Car was triggering hit switch permanently and needed adjustment as springs were barely pulling. Flippers were loose. All the coils were replaced for no reason (amateur thinking they wear out). Coil connections are all badly crimped connectors instead of solder. Bunch of wires had popped out of the shitty crimps. Still have to cut/strip/solder those crimped connections that are still holding as they will eventually fail. Broken resistor leg on opto board. DMD has 2 columns out. Double target was jammed together and both stuck on. Left lower VUK still super weak as everything in that mech is loose and screws stripped. Legs are wrong(not Gtb) and tremclad painted. Leg bolts are wrong(mix of 5/8 and 9/16). Levellers are homemade weird contraptions. No key for BG-permanently unlocked which means the BG popped out in transport but no damage. Pic of subway ramps getting cleaned off in ultrasonic. Man they were disgusting! Other than that YES it was “just a fuse”.
